Пример #1
0
        public void SetupTest()
        {
            usuarioRepositorio = new UsuarioMockRepositorio();
            usuarioFactory     = new UsuarioFactory(new LoginJaExisteSpecification(usuarioRepositorio), new LoginValidoSpecification(), new SenhaValidaSpecification());
            LoginJaExisteSpecification loginJaExiste = new LoginJaExisteSpecification(usuarioRepositorio);

            usuarioFactory.LoginEmUsoSpecification = loginJaExiste;
            loginService = new LoginService(usuarioRepositorio, usuarioFactory, SessaoLogin.getSessao());

            usuarioRepositorio.save(usuarioFactory.criarUsuario("João", "joaozinho", "123456"));
            usuarioRepositorio.save(usuarioFactory.criarUsuario("Maria", "maria", "123456"));
        }
Пример #2
0
        public void SetupTest()
        {
            usuarioRepositorio = new UsuarioMockRepositorio();
            usuarioFactory     = new UsuarioFactory(new LoginJaExisteSpecification(usuarioRepositorio), new LoginValidoSpecification(), new SenhaValidaSpecification());
            funcionarioFactory = new FuncionarioFactory();

            usuarioRepositorio.save(usuarioFactory.criarUsuario("João", "joaozinho", "123456"));
        }
Пример #3
0
        public void testCriarUsuario()
        {
            usuarioRepositorio.save(
                usuarioFactory.criarUsuario("Guilherme", "guilherme_latrova", "latrova123")
                );

            Assert.IsNotNull(usuarioRepositorio.findByLogin("guilherme_latrova"));
        }